&lt;div&gt;&amp;lt;br&amp;gt;Immediate action: clear your browser cache and reload the exact address. In Chrome open Menu (⋮) → Settings → Privacy → Clear browsing data; select Cached images and files, set Time range to All time, tap Clear data, then paste the URL again. If you use another browser, open its settings and remove cached site data the same way.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;If the page still returns &amp;quot;page not found&amp;quot;, verify connection and DNS resolution: toggle Airplane mode for ~10 seconds or turn Wi‑Fi off/on, then test the URL in an alternate browser or in incognito/private mode. Try replacing or removing &amp;quot;www.&amp;quot; and switch between http and https to rule out protocol mismatches. Use an external site‑availability checker from a desktop or a remote network to confirm whether the problem is local or server‑side.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;When an app shows the missing page message, clear that app's cache and data: Settings → Apps → select the app → Storage → Clear Cache / Clear Data, then force‑stop and reopen. Update the app and the browser via Google Play Store, and, if nothing changes, collect diagnostics for the webmaster: full request URL, exact timestamp (with timezone), browser user agent, and response headers. For site owners, review server logs, redirect rules (.htaccess or server config), DNS records and TTL, and any recent deploys or deleted routes that could cause a removed resource to return a &amp;quot;page not found&amp;quot; response.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Quick URL and Connection Checks&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Enter the complete address in the browser bar: include the protocol (https:// or http://), the exact hostname (www versus naked domain), and the full path; reload the page after each small edit.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Verify URL syntax: remove any trailing slash or add it to test both variants; convert path segments to the correct case (paths are case-sensitive on many servers); replace spaces and special characters with percent-encoding (space → %20); strip the fragment (#...) and query string (?key=val) to test the base resource.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Try both hostname variants (example. If one resolves and the other does not, add or remove the www and retry or use a temporary redirect test with a different browser or device.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Inspect TLS details by tapping the padlock in the address bar: check that the certificate covers the requested hostname and that the validity dates are current. If the certificate name doesn’t match the hostname, the browser may block the page.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Switch network paths: toggle between Wi‑Fi and mobile data on your device; enable airplane mode for 10 seconds then disable it; reboot the router. If the page loads on a different network, test changing DNS to 8.8.8.8 (Google) or 1.1.1.1 (Cloudflare) on the device or router and retry.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Use web-based checks when local tools are limited: paste the domain into https://dns.google/resolve?name=example.com&amp;amp;amp;type=A, https://dnschecker.org, or https://downforeveryoneorjustme.com/example.com to confirm DNS propagation and global reachability.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Run basic diagnostics from a computer: macOS/Linux – dig +short example.com, curl -I https://example.com, traceroute example.com; Windows – nslookup example.com, tracert example.com, curl -I https://example.com. If DNS resolves but the server returns a &amp;quot;page not found&amp;quot; response, the problem is likely path-related on the host.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;If the hostname resolves and the base site works but the specific URL does not, check for redirects, removed pages or typos in the path; test the site's homepage and use its search or sitemap to locate the current URL, or contact the site administrator with the exact URL and timestamps of your attempts.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Verify exact URL spelling and path&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Type or paste the complete address into the browser's address bar and correct any mismatch character-for-character with the intended resource.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Protocol and port: confirm the scheme and port match the server (examples: https://example.com vs http://example.com:8080); an incorrect scheme or custom port changes the request target.&amp;lt;br&amp;gt;Domain and subdomain: verify subdomain spelling (example: www.example.com ≠ example.com); check for typos, extra dots, hyphens and international names (use an IDN/punycode converter if domain contains non-ASCII characters).&amp;lt;br&amp;gt;Case sensitivity in path segments: many servers treat /Folder/Page.html differently from /folder/page.html – match exact capitalization for each path segment and filename.&amp;lt;br&amp;gt;Trailing slash vs no trailing slash: /folder and /folder/ can point to different resources; try both forms if the resource is missing.&amp;lt;br&amp;gt;File extensions and implicit index: confirm whether the server expects an extension (example: /about vs /about.html) or serves index files for directories (example: /blog/ → /blog/index.html).&amp;lt;br&amp;gt;Percent-encoding and spaces: replace spaces and non-ASCII characters with percent-encoding (example: /file name.html → /file%20name.html); do not rely on browser heuristics for encoding when debugging.&amp;lt;br&amp;gt;Query string exactness: verify parameter names, values and encoding (example: ?q=hello+world vs ?q=hello%20world); some backends treat parameter order or encoding differently.&amp;lt;br&amp;gt;Fragment identifiers (#): fragments are client-side only and are not sent to the server; remove everything after # when checking the server-side address.&amp;lt;br&amp;gt;Invisible characters and copy-paste artifacts: retype suspicious characters if the link came from a message or PDF – zero-width spaces, non-breaking spaces and smart quotes commonly corrupt pasted URLs.&amp;lt;br&amp;gt;Relative vs absolute paths: confirm the link is resolved against the correct base URL; check for unintended &amp;quot;../&amp;quot; segments that change the directory level.&amp;lt;br&amp;gt;Hosting-specific keys: for object storage (S3, CDN) verify object key exact match including case, slashes and file extension.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Quick verification commands and inspections:&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Show just response headers and follow redirects: curl -I -L &amp;quot;https://example.com/path/to/resource&amp;quot;&amp;lt;br&amp;gt;See final request URL and status: curl -v &amp;quot;https://example.com/path/to/resource&amp;quot; (inspect the Request URL line and response code)&amp;lt;br&amp;gt;In browser: open Developer Tools → Network → reload page → inspect the Request URL column and Response headers to confirm what the browser actually requested.&amp;lt;br&amp;gt;To detect hidden characters: paste the URL into a plain-text editor that can show invisibles or run a small char-code check in the browser console (print character codes) and scan for unexpected code points.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;After correcting spelling, encoding and path segments, reload the address or re-run the curl command to confirm the resource is reachable at the exact specified URL.&amp;lt;br&amp;gt;&lt;/div&gt;</summary>

&lt;div&gt;&amp;lt;br&amp;gt;Install only official OTA packages or factory images from the device vendor. Create a complete backup first (cloud sync plus local copy of photos and an application data export where possible); ensure battery is ≥80% and use a data-capable USB cable and stable port; verify downloaded image integrity against the vendor's SHA-256 checksum before flashing.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Prepare the handset for flashing. Enable Developer options (tap Build number seven times), enable USB debugging and OEM unlocking if a manual flash is required. Check bootloader status with 'fastboot flashing getvar unlocked' or the vendor tool; remember that unlocking typically triggers a factory reset and can affect encryption and warranty. Use official platform-tools or the vendor-recommended utility (for example, Odin on certain brands) and follow the manufacturer’s exact command sequence to avoid bricking.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Pick the path that matches your tolerance for risk: official OTA delivered via Settings preserves vendor integrity checks and can keep user data, 'adb sideload' is useful when OTA fails, and manual flashing of factory images offers the quickest recovery but carries the highest risk. Keep a copy of the original build and recovery, record build number and bootloader state, test core functions (telephony, Wi‑Fi, biometric unlock, full-disk encryption) after the process, and consult the vendor guide or model-specific community threads for verified checksums and commands for your exact model.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Firmware vs Operating System: practical distinctions&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Recommendation: modify low-level images (boot, radio, recovery) only to fix hardware behavior or boot failures; apply a new system release for UI, app framework and security patches.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Scope and responsibility&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Firmware: hardware initialization, bootloader, radio/baseband, power management and vendor blobs.&amp;lt;br&amp;gt;Operating system: system services, framework APIs, user interface, app runtime and package management.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Storage and partitions&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Boot partition: kernel + ramdisk (typically 16–64 MB). Replace when kernel-level fixes are needed.&amp;lt;br&amp;gt;Recovery: recovery image (16–64 MB). Used for flashing and restore operations.&amp;lt;br&amp;gt;Radio / modem: separate binary blobs (from a few MB to &amp;gt;100 MB) stored in dedicated partitions.&amp;lt;br&amp;gt;System / vendor: OS files and vendor libraries (system images commonly 1–4 GB; vendor 50–500 MB).&amp;lt;br&amp;gt;A/B schemes: two system sets for seamless switching; firmware parts may remain single-slot.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Change frequency and delivery&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Firmware changes are infrequent, high-risk, and often delivered as full images via manufacturer tools or service centers.&amp;lt;br&amp;gt;OS releases and security patches are distributed more regularly, via incremental packages or full images.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Risk profile and recovery&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Flashing incorrect firmware can brick hardware-level functionality (radio, sensors). Recovery may require emergency modes (EDL, JTAG) or manufacturer service.&amp;lt;br&amp;gt;OS flashes usually affect apps and UI; soft brick recovery is often possible from custom or stock recovery images and backups.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Security and verification&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Secure boot / verified boot validate signatures before execution; firmware images and bootloader are typically signed by OEM keys.&amp;lt;br&amp;gt;OS packages may use signature checks and dm-verity to prevent tampering with system partitions.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Practical file types and tools&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Common image extensions: .img, .bin, .elf; package containers: .zip, .tar.&amp;lt;br&amp;gt;Flashing tools by chipset/OEM: fastboot, adb sideload, Odin (Samsung), Mi Flash, SP Flash Tool, QPST; use the tool matching device architecture.&amp;lt;br&amp;gt;Commands (examples): fastboot flash boot boot.img; fastboot flash system system.img; adb sideload package.zip.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Checklist before flashing low-level pieces&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Confirm exact model and hardware revision; check build fingerprint and carrier variant.&amp;lt;br&amp;gt;Backup user data and make a full image (nandroid) if possible.&amp;lt;br&amp;gt;Verify file checksums and digital signatures supplied by vendor.&amp;lt;br&amp;gt;Ensure battery ≥50% and USB connection stable.&amp;lt;br&amp;gt;Unlock bootloader only when necessary; relock after successful procedure if security is required.&amp;lt;br&amp;gt;Test radio, sensors and camera immediately after flashing vendor firmware.&amp;lt;br&amp;gt;Keep official recovery media or service contacts available for emergency restoration.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Short decision guide&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;If the problem is lost network, modem crashes or bootloop before OS loads → target firmware (boot, radio, bootloader).&amp;lt;br&amp;gt;If the problem is UI glitches, app crashes, API regressions or security patches → replace the system image or install a system patch package.&amp;lt;br&amp;gt;If unsure, prefer OEM-supplied full images and follow vendor instructions; avoid mixing firmware from different revisions or carriers.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;What firmware actually controls on Android devices&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Use only vendor-signed low-level images for bootloader, baseband/modem, PMIC and secure-element modules; verify signatures and back up the EFS/IMEI area before making changes.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Low-level code governs hardware initialization and security: on most SoCs an immutable boot ROM hands control to a staged bootloader (sbl1/abl), which performs cryptographic verification of the next stages and enforces bootloader lock state. Incompatible radio blobs commonly produce loss of network, wrong band support or IMEI/EFS corruption.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Power-management firmware (rpm, pmic) and thermal microcode control charging algorithms, fuel-gauge reporting, voltage rails and thermal throttling. Incorrect versions can cause fast battery drain, overheating or failed charging. Storage controller firmware inside UFS/eMMC manages wear-leveling, bad-block tables and hardware encryption; damaging it can render the storage unreadable.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Peripherals often contain their own microcode: Wi‑Fi/Bluetooth chips, touchscreen controllers, camera ISPs, sensor hubs and audio DSPs (adsp/dsp) run proprietary binaries that handle radio stacks, touch sampling, image processing, sensor fusion and low-power always-on tasks. Replacing these without vendor compatibility checks leads to degraded performance or loss of functionality.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Typical partitions and blobs to be aware of: sbl1, aboot/abl, rpm, tz, hyp, dsp/adsp, modem/NON-HLOS.bin, efs, boot, vendor_boot, dtbo, vbmeta, and vendor-specific names (Qualcomm vs MediaTek: sbl1/preloader, lk). Never overwrite EFS; back it up with platform tools or by dd (for example: adb shell su -c &amp;quot;dd if=/dev/block/by-name/efs of=/sdcard/efs.img&amp;quot; &amp;amp;amp;&amp;amp;amp; adb pull /sdcard/efs.img) or vendor backup utilities.&amp;lt;br&amp;gt; &am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Commands to inspect low-level versions and lock state: check Settings → About phone for baseband and bootloader strings; via command line use adb shell getprop gsm.version.baseband and adb shell getprop ro.bootloader; use fastboot getvar all or fastboot oem device-info to read bootloader lock status and partition info. Review dmesg/logcat for firmware-load messages when drivers initialize.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Risks and compatibility rules: match firmware to exact model and carrier region; mixing images across models or SoC revisions often breaks radios, IMEI/EFS or encryption. Unlocking the bootloader typically wipes keymaster/TEE data and disables verified-boot protections; re-locking without restoring vendor-signed images may leave the device non-bootable.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Practical checklist before any low-level change: 1) record current bootloader/baseband/dsp versions; 2) back up EFS and userdata; 3) obtain vendor-signed images for the exact SKU and carrier; 4) verify image signatures (AVB/vbmeta where present); 5) apply changes using vendor tooling or documented fastboot/adb procedures; 6) validate cellular, Wi‑Fi, camera and charging behavior immediately after the operation; 7) re-lock bootloader if security needs to be restored.&amp;lt;br&amp;gt;&lt;/div&gt;</summary>

&lt;div&gt;&amp;lt;br&amp;gt;For widest app selection, fastest updates and built-in casting, pick sets running Google's operating system; for simpler menus, fewer background services and lower price, select manufacturer-built firmware.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Update policy: Google's platform commonly receives major OS upgrades for 2–3 years plus regular security and services patches. Many makers offer about 1 major upgrade and irregular patches–confirm official support timeline from vendor before purchase.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;App availability: Google Play on Google's platform provides a broad catalog of large-screen-optimized apps and easier sideloading. Popular streaming clients such as Netflix, Prime Video and Disney+ are often preinstalled across both platform types, but app presence depends on model and regional licensing.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Performance and gaming: With comparable silicon, UI responsiveness and video decoding are similar across platforms. On low-end chipsets, maker firmware can feel snappier due to lighter background processes, while Google's platform enables wider app compatibility. Expect input lag in game mode roughly 10–30 ms on modern panels; request manufacturer measurements for any panel intended for competitive gaming.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Privacy and data: Google's platform integrates with Google account and delivers personalized recommendations and cross-device syncing. If minimizing data sharing matters, prefer maker firmware or enforce network-level filters and disable optional telemetry inside settings.&amp;lt;br&amp;gt; &am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Quick buying rules: choose Google's platform when you need extensive app catalog, seamless casting, regular security updates and strong voice-assistant/streaming integrations; choose maker firmware when you want a simpler interface, lower cost, reduced background activity and region-specific app bundles.
